What Actually Is KupidAI? (Spoiler: It’s Not Just Horny Chatbots)

First off, let’s be clear about what we’re dealing with.KupidAI - Premium AI Companion Chat for Realistic Virtual Datinglaunched a while back, but it’s seen a massive uptick in 2026. The basic premise: you create or select an AI companion — complete with a name, personality traits, backstory, and appearance — then interact with it via text. The interactions are surprisingly deep. The AI remembers past conversations, adapts its personality based on your choices, and even initiates “romantic” scenarios if you steer things that way.

It’s classified under “Adult Gaming” on most platforms, which is accurate. But calling it just a game undersells it. The tech behind it uses a custom large language model fine-tuned for emotional and romantic engagement. No generic ChatGPT stuff here. These companions feel… intentional. They’ll flirt, argue, support, and even “grow” with you over time. Check the top-rated KupidAI - Premium AI Companion Chat for Realistic Virtual Dating here.

The $9.99/month fee gets you unlimited chat, access to premium personality templates, and the ability to create multiple companions. There’s a free tier, but it’s heavily restricted — 50 messages per day and no adult content. The paid version removes those limits.

The Appeal of Zero Drama

Here’s the thing: real relationships are work. They’re compromises, arguments about whose turn it is to do dishes, checking phone locations, dealing with family drama. KupidAI strips all that away. You get the decent parts — the compliments, the deep conversations, the feeling of being wanted — without the baggage. For people who’ve been burned, that’s intoxicating.

But there’s a trap. The more you rely on a perfect AI partner, the less tolerance you have for imperfect humans. I’ve seen guys in forums admit they’ve stopped pursuing real dates because “the AI is better.” That’s a red flag the size of Texas.KupidAI virtual dating vs real relationshipis a false dichotomy if you let the AI replace your social life entirely. Test it as a supplement, not a substitute — that’s the line between healthy exploration and dangerous isolation.

The Tech Behind the Illusion

I’m not going to bore you with token counts or model architectures. But I will say this: KupidAI’s conversational quality is head and shoulders above every other AI companion I’ve tested in 2026. The memory system is impressive — it remembers not just facts but emotional context. If you tell it you’re scared of public speaking, it’ll bring that up weeks later when you mention a presentation. That’s the kind of continuity that makes the illusion stick.

The “premium” companions at the $9.99/month tier are pre-built with detailed backstories. You’ve got the “Supportive Artist,” the “Intellectual Philosopher,” the “Playful Adventurer.” Each has a defined personality that evolves based on your interactions. The free tier gives you generic ones, and honestly, they feel hollow. You need the paid version to get the full effect — which is exactly how they hook you.
